Output 09e62b826a23b335723ef54b9fbed1b5c2402b1abd36d089951d231264701975:20

value
40114848
script pubkey
OP_0 OP_PUSHBYTES_32 1fa670ce2a2c72b0a20c0840a9700cfc503f2639f40e759c4cb8d26cf5d8a5c7
address
bc1qr7n8pn3293etpgsvppq2juqvl3gr7f3e7s88t8zvhrfxeawc5hrsz5yr04
transaction
09e62b826a23b335723ef54b9fbed1b5c2402b1abd36d089951d231264701975
spent
true